Electrical systems are increasing in complexity across many industries. More sensors, more control units, and a growing demand to manage late changes without introducing errors or delays in manufacturing.
In this webinar, we will demonstrate how Siemens Capital Essentials supports a structured workflow from initial functional schematic design through to harness manufacturing documentation. The session is designed for small and mid-sized R&D teams looking to reduce manual rework, improve data consistency, and shorten development cycles.
We will show:
- Functional schematic design and signal definition
- Voltage drop analysis directly in the schematic stage
- Importing functional data into harness design
- Automatic pin mapping, wire assignment and branching
- Design Rule Checks to detect and prevent issues early
- Efficient handling of late design changes
- Automatic generation of wire lists and manufacturing drawings
- A short look at how the same data model can scale into the full Capital platform, including hydraulics
